Finding a string in Notes
September 24, 2008, 12:34:51 pm
When I am attempting to do an advanced search in Notes:
(http://bradjensen.info/files/images/example3.preview.jpg)
The results that are returned are only where the text that I am searching for is exactly equal to the entire contents of the note, such as here:
(http://bradjensen.info/files/images/example.preview.JPG)
But will not find people like this one:
(http://bradjensen.info/files/images/example4.preview.jpg)

I get the same results in the search builder.

Re: Finding a string in Notes
September 24, 2008, 12:47:54 pm
You should use "DDP%" for searching.

Re: Finding a string in Notes
September 24, 2008, 11:40:36 pm
Actually there was a minor bug in Advanced Search. Now you can search without wildcards.
